My oldest son (15) and I went to Madrid for the last week of June 2011. I wanted to stay at a hotel a little closer to the city center, but becasue I had Marriott points and they just acquired this hotel we decided to stay here. The hotel is GORGEOUS and very non-Marriott hotel looking. It is an old masion that was also once an embassy, but is now a lovely small high end hotel. The staff was extrodinary (went over and above each day from arranging our dinner, taxis, room requests etc), our room was perfection and the upscale neighborhood that it was located in made us feel very safe to walk no matter what time of day or night.

The food is crazy expensive ($45 for breakfast for one), but we found a small cafe less then 5 minutes walk away and ate their every morning and ate lunch and dinner in various places in Madrid depending on what site seeing we were doing that day.

The walk into the downtown area every morning was easy (about 10-15 minutes) and we only returned to the hotel in the evenng to get ready to go out to dinner. There are 2 really good restaurants taht are a 5 minute walk where we ate twice. Each night we took a taxi back to the hotel because while it is only a 10-15 minute walk, we had walked all day and were tired.

I would definetly stay there again!!

Used Marriott points for 2 rooms for 2 nights, so I can't complain about the cost, but definitely not worth the going rate which I understand is over 300 euros per night, per room. Rooms adequate in size, but nothing special. Upon returning to the hotel after midnight the first night, we found the air conditioning in one room was not working. Another room was provided, but we had to pack up and move ourselves with no apology or compensation such as a complimentary breakfast. Even when working the ac was working it was barely adequate. Because my wife is Platinum with Marriott she was entitled to a free breakfast each morning which she did not use. I had one cup of coffee the first morning (no one came around with refills), but because I was not staying in my wife's room (I was with my son and she was with my daughter) they insisted I pay 8 euros for the coffee. Eventually a manager intervened to say there would be no charge. Overall the stay was a disappointment.
